INSTALLING DRIVERS FOR

WINDOWS NT 4.0

To install the modem driver:

1.When Windows starts, login using an account with Administrator privileges.

2.Locate and run the SETUP.EXE program for your modem driver.

3.When the program starts, click the Install button. After the files are copied, the modem driver is installed.

REMOVING THE MODEM FROM

WINDOWS NT 4.0

To uninstall the modem:

1.Be sure you are logged into an account with Administrator privileges.

2.Locate and run the SETUP.EXE program for your modem driver.

3.When the program starts, click the Uninstall button. When prompted, restart your computer.
